我有一个网站,人们会预订网站访问。支持执行确认前一天的网站访问。在网站访问发生当天确认网站访问后,客户应在早上收到短信,告知您今天可以按要求进行现场访问。
我有第三方短信服务
现在我应该在PHP中运行一个代码,MySQL会在早上发送一个短信发送网站
我该怎么做
答案 0 :(得分:1)
你需要一个cron作业集在早上运行,这将调用你的php文件有代码,用于查找需要发送短信的客户的数据库。
哟需要注册和sms网关提供2个好的,我知道是clickatell和eztexting。
你可以在那里的网站上发送短信api。
快乐的嘘声:D
答案 1 :(得分:1)
Cron - >启动PHP脚本,PHP脚本从SQL表中读取记录并检查是否必须发送SMS,我假设它是短信通过邮件,因此您可以使用集成的php函数将邮件发送到sms网关。对于确认访问的人,创建另一个具有适当身份验证的站点,他可以访问该表并同意站点访问,另一个站点供客户注册站点访问
答案 2 :(得分:0)
在“控制面板”中设置Cron作业。尝试此链接 http://www.devx.com/DevX/Article/39900/1954
答案 3 :(得分:0)
如果您想尝试完全不同的方法,请查看: Sent.ly - http://sent.ly
我是Sent.ly的创始人并且认为也许Sent.ly可以帮助你...
Sent.ly允许您将Android手机用作SMS网关。所以......你可以购买便宜的Android手机(150美元左右)并在其上设置Sent.ly并将SIM卡放入手机中。
通过调用Sent.ly API,短信将通过Android手机中的SIM卡进行。 Sent.ly还可以选择安排SMS以便稍后发送,这是您的使用案例。
除了发送短信之外,这还允许您的PHP应用程序接收短信。
您可以设置规则,如果传入的消息与规则匹配,则会将其发布到您选择的PHP页面。
由于我是stackoverflow的忠实粉丝,我想邀请您尝试Sent.ly.如果您愿意,我们很乐意为您安排额外的学分。只需发送电子邮件至support@sent.ly
即可干杯,
Varun的
答案 4 :(得分:0)
我开发了一个这样的系统供我的一些客户使用,你可以通过HTTP POST或WebServices(使用PHP,C#或其他任何东西)轻松地将它用于与您的网站或应用程序集成。
如果您有兴趣,只需留下电子邮件或其他联系信息作为对此答案的回复,我很乐意向您发送示例代码,说明如何发送短信,设置发送短信所需的时间,超出其他内容,通过我们的系统
你不需要任何类型的cron知识和设置,它都由我们的系统处理,代码非常简单直接。您只需在现场访问确认时调用我们的服务,设置所需的消息发送时间,我们的系统将完成其余的工作。
最好的问候。